The latest officially reported population of Palau was 17,695 in 2024 vs 10,694,681 people in Portugal in 2024. In 2026, based on the adjusted UN estimation, the current Palau's population is 17,618 people compared to 10,663,982 in Portugal.
Population statistics:
- Portugal's population is 605 times bigger than Palau's.
- Palau is ranked the 194th most populous country in the world, while Portugal is the 92nd.
- The countries together account for 0.13% of the world: 0.0002% for Palau vs 0.13% for Portugal.
- For the last 10 years, Palau has had an average growth rate of +0.02% per year vs +0.21% in Portugal.
- Since 2006, the population of Palau has decreased from 19.6K people to 17.6K (10.1% decline), while Portugal has grown from 10.5M to 10.7M (1.35% growth).
- Both countries are in a period of decline and in 50 years are projected to lose 27.3% of the population in Palau and 14.2% in Portugal.

From 2006 to 2016, the population of Palau decreased by 1,796 people (a 9.17% decline), while Portugal lost 196,836 people (a 1.87% decline).
For the next 10 years, from 2016 to 2026, Palau lost -179 (a 1.01% decline), while Portugal's population increased by 338,530 (a 3.28% growth).
Palau was ranked 194th most populous country in 2006 and is still 194th in 2026. Portugal was ranked 78th in 2006 and ranked 92nd now.
The UN's World Population Prospects forecasts that with changing growth rate trends in 24 years (in 2050) Palau's population will shrink by 11.9% to 15,515 people with a rank change from 194th to 195th. The population of Portugal will decrease by 6.01% to 10,022,734 people and rank change from 92nd to 97th.
